Equivalent Hamiltonian Systems for Differential Equations with Even Order Derivatives

Abstract

New approaches are proposed in the problem of constructing equivalent Hamiltonian systems for linear Lur’e equations (differential equations containing derivatives of even orders only). The approaches are based on the transition to the normal forms of the corresponding Hamiltonian systems with subsequent transformation of the resulting system. The proposed scheme does not require complex and cumbersome transformations of the original equation. It is shown that this problem is uniquely solvable. The appendix provides similar results for systems with two degrees of freedom. The effectiveness of the proposed formulas is illustrated by examples.
